A 38-year-old grandmother has shared how she and her 20-year-old daughter are frequently mistaken for being twins.

Brittany Desborough has gained the title of ‘world’s hottest grandmother’ from numerous social media followers after her teenage daughter, Makenzie, gave birth two years ago.

Hailing from California, Brittany, a mother of four, became pregnant with Makenzie at the age of 17. As Makenzie grew up, the duo often garnered ‘a lot of attention’ for their remarkably similar appearances when seen together in public.

“Many people confused us for sisters or even twins and were surprised to learn that we were actually mother and daughter,” Brittany explained.

“Some even thought that Makenzie was my mother. It was quite difficult to distinguish us.”

“Fortunately, she always found the situation amusing, and I took it as a huge compliment,” she added.

Brittany met her husband Chris, now 39, at a school party. Just eight months into their whirlwind romance, the teenagers became engaged. 

Then, just a few months later, Brittany discovered she was pregnant.

Recalling her initial fears that having a baby in her teenage years would ‘ruin’ her life, Brittany said: ‘I knew Chris wanted to have kids right away, but we were both so young. Thankfully, he was over the moon.’

Reflecting on the challenges she faced, Brittany added: ‘While most of my friends were partying and applying for university, I had no choice but to grow up.’ 

The loved-up pair later went on to have Savannah, 11, followed by Charlie, nine and finally Hunter, born in 2024.

Meanwhile, Brittany stuck to a rigid daily skincare routine to keep her youthful looks in check.

Such routine consisted of cleanser, glycolic acid, niacinamide and zinc, gel moisturiser, squalene oil, Vaseline and crows-tape feet. 

But just a few months after Brittany welcomed her youngest son, she made the surprising discovery that her teenage daughter, then aged 18, was pregnant.

‘I found her curled up in bed staring at the wall. It was like deja vu,’ recalled Brittany. 

‘All I felt was sympathy. Myself and Chris supported her and she seriously knuckled down.’

Now, they’re working towards building an annex for Makenzie and her son, Banks, while they navigate their expanding family.

Brittany added: ‘It was strange having a grandson and a son less than a year apart, but I wouldn’t change it for anything. Hunter loves his nephew very much.

‘People are even more surprised now when I tell them I’m a grandma.

‘But it goes to show; us grannies come in all shapes, sizes and good looks.’
